Impulse Analysis tool
This tool was developed to analyse impulse measurements on high voltage towers, specifically for the ZED meter, but it may also be used with other data, as long as the input format is respected (see example data). Be aware of the influence of the settings. The user is advised to investigate which settings are most suitable for the analysis. One advise on the start time is to start after ‘0’ (e.g. at 100ns) to exclude any reflections of the tower and the connections to the shielding wires.
